Security
Lack of security is a major hazard relating to the survival of your business. Most small businesses can’t afford to hire a full-time and experienced IT systems administrator, and that’s where the trouble starts. If your systems are unprotected, you risk cybersecurity breaches and data compromise and theft. And when the data is gone, it’s gone. You could end up saying goodbye to your precious enterprise.

Experience
Most small businesses start out with little or no IT experience to speak of. At the very best, they may have a semi-experienced IT specialist who is unable to cope with supply and demand. Let’s say that your business is thriving, and we hope that it is! You need to increase your workforce, increase your online presence and expand to new platforms. All these things need to be achieved as a matter of urgency for the natural development of your business. The problem? Your single IT guy will be unable to manage the workload.

Communication
Experts claim that the number one factor contributing to the success of a company is effective communication. Communication includes that between employees, external vendors, clients and partners. It is also essential that you preserve these relationships and improve them. Technology makes this easier than ever before but there are still challenges that you need to be aware of.
In these days of BYOD, your employees need to be online 24/7 and respond rapidly to client emails and messages. BYOD devices also need to be fully compliant and secure within your company. Also, you need to have a VPN available.
